[QUOTE="Chubbs, post: 52010, member: 1084"] What's the set-up like? Being arboreal the tarantula should be in a tall enclosure and have something to climb on and attach webbing to ,such as a slab of cork bark. Touching it is definitely not going to help anything and will likely just stress it out more. I keep Avics with lots of cross-ventilation and no misting, just a water dish. The abdomen looks pretty plump. Might just be approaching a molt. [/QUOTE]
